Strategies for Maximizing College Savings
Automatic Contributions and Dollar-Cost Averaging
Imagine planting seeds today that will bloom into a future full of opportunity—this is the essence of a strategic college education savings plan. Automating contributions transforms this vision into reality, ensuring consistent growth without the burden of manual effort. By setting up automatic contributions, you turn savings into a seamless habit, allowing the magic of compounding to work silently over time. It’s a powerful way to stay committed, even amidst life’s unpredictable twists and turns.
Another compelling strategy is dollar-cost averaging, which involves investing a fixed amount regularly regardless of market fluctuations. This approach reduces the risk of investing a lump sum at the wrong moment and smooths out the impact of market volatility. For a college education savings plan, this method ensures your funds grow steadily and steadily, safeguarding your child’s future education expenses. Incorporating both automatic contributions and dollar-cost averaging creates a robust, resilient plan—one that adapts and thrives through the seasons of financial change.

Common Mistakes and How to Avoid Them
Overfunding or Underfunding
Even the most well-intentioned college education savings plan can falter if certain pitfalls are overlooked. Overfunding a savings account might seem like a safety net, but it can lead to unnecessary taxes or forfeited financial aid. Conversely, underfunding leaves future students scrambling for resources, potentially delaying their academic aspirations or forcing them to take on burdensome student loans.
One common mistake is misjudging the true cost of college education. Without a realistic assessment, families risk either pouring too much or too little into their college education savings plan. It’s essential to strike a balance—saving enough to cover expenses while maintaining flexibility for other financial priorities.
To avoid these errors, consider implementing a systematic review of your contributions annually or upon major life changes. This approach ensures your college education savings plan remains aligned with evolving goals and economic conditions. Remember, the key is to stay adaptable—rigid plans often fall short when circumstances shift unexpectedly.

Neglecting Investment Diversification
One of the most insidious mistakes in managing a college education savings plan is neglecting investment diversification. It’s tempting to pour resources into what seems familiar or promising, but this approach often leaves your savings exposed to unnecessary risk. When all eggs are in one basket, a downturn in that sector can derail years of diligent planning, threatening your child’s future educational opportunities.
To guard against this, a balanced and well-diversified portfolio is essential. Diversification isn’t just about spreading investments; it’s about creating a resilient financial ecosystem that can withstand market turbulence. Incorporating a mix of asset classes—such as equities, bonds, and cash equivalents—can help stabilize your college education savings plan over time.
- Regularly review your investment allocations
- Adjust holdings in response to market shifts
- Seek professional guidance to optimize diversification strategies
Remember, the strength of your college education savings plan hinges on the subtle art of diversification—protecting your future while navigating the unpredictable currents of the financial landscape.
